A KILLING RECORD.

FEILDING FREEZING WORKS. • Since the Feilding Freezing Works opened on December 10th, stock have been coming forward in good supply and no effort is being spared to make the season a record one. So far very satisfactory support has been received from the settlers of this, and the surrounding districts, and with the free co-operation of all stock raisers the next balance sheet should disclose a very much improved condition of affairs. 1 On Tuesday' the killing board .put up a record when three thousand and eighty-two lambs were dealt with. It is hoped before long to increase this figure to four thousand a day. A maintenance of such activity will mean much to the town and the business community which supports it. '
